1226 is a 5-digit zip code located in Dalton, Massachusetts. Dalton is the primary city for 1226 and is located in Green Lake. In the most recent US census the population of 1226 was 6324.

There are a total of 2,927 housing units in 1226, Massachusetts. A total of 4.07% (119) are currently vacant.

Population Figures for 1226

Total Population by Age

1226 has a total population of 6,324. In the bar chart and table below, this population is split into 18 different age range segments.

Most inhabitants of 1226 are in the 60 to 64 years age bracket. As of the last census, there are 577 people in this segment.

The 80 to 84 years segment is the smallest age range in 1226. There are just 116 people in this category.

Race and Gender Population of 1226

Women make up the highest portion of people in 1226. There are 3,003 men and 3,329 women in this 5-digit zip code.

There are no people who identify as: American Indian, Native Hawaiian in this 1226 zip code.

Most people in this zip code are White, with a total of 5,998 people in this category.
